Tire Casing Definition . The tire casing is the body of the tire and includes components such as the bead, belt system, sidewall, body ply and inner liner—basically everything except the tread. Approximately 70 percent of a tire’s value is in the casing. This foundation upon which the tread sets is the supporting structure of the tire. An effective tire casing management program will help you optimize tire runout and casing life, delivering the lowest possible cost per mile.
